Dime Commercial Bancshares has As a regional bank, Dime Community Bancshares Inc has minimal exposure to tariffs. Its operations are domestically focused, with no significant import/export activities, providing high resilience to trade policy changes.

Tariff Resilience Score is a ranking system developed by GuruFocus to measure a company's exposure to international trade tariffs, rated on a scale from 0 to 10. It takes into account key factors such as global supply chain dependencies, manufacturing locations versus sales markets, import / export balance and percentage of revenue, and more.

The company's exposure to international trade tariffs based on these criteria:

1. Global supply chain dependencies
2. Manufacturing locations versus sales markets
3. Import/export balance and percentage of revenue
4. Historical impact from previous tariff changes
5. Available mitigation strategies (alternative suppliers, pricing power)
6. Industry-specific tariff exemptions or vulnerabilities

Dime Commercial Bancshares Business Description

Other Exchanges DCOMp.PFD:USADCOM:USA
Address 898 Veterans Memorial Highway, Suite 560, Hauppauge, NY, USA, 11788
Dime Commercial Bancshares Inc is the holding company for Dime Commercial Bank, a New York State-chartered trust company with approximately $15 billion in assets and the number one deposit market share on Greater Long Island.
